    FILE - In this March 20, 2017, file photo, Cuonzo Martin waves as he walks out to be formally introduced as the new basketball coach at Missouri, in Columbia, Mo. Martin is no stranger to Missouri, having grown up just across the Mississippi River in East St. Louis and coached in the state before at Missouri State. Now the former Tennessee and Cal coach is back home with the Tigers, where he thinks the rejuvenated basketball program could be a much-needed source of pride for a Missouri campus still reeling from student protests two years ago.
